We are looking for an Assistant Designer, Electrical to join our team!What You will DoReporting to the Senior Design Engineer, Electrical, you will be responsible for providing technical support in the preparation, analysis, monitoring and co-ordination of new projects or modifications to existing equipment as related to the design and testing of TTC's systems and equipment for the department.Other responsibilities of your role will include:
- Assisting with the preparation of estimates, material lists, specifications, standards, policies, work methods, test procedures and drawings.
- Conducting engineering analyses, evaluations, tests and drawing conclusions.
- Conducting investigations into electrical, signaling or track problems, and detecting new areas that require engineering attention to improve safety, productivity and cost effectiveness.
- Preparing and reviewing electrical designs and documentation, and assisting with the preparation of drawings, estimates, material lists, specifications, standards, policies, work methods, test procedures and site inspections in accordance with TTC and Industry Design Standards and Codes.
- Reviewing and interpreting drawings and specifications for accuracy and ensure that all detailed factors have been correctly incorporated.
- Assisting with electrical asset management configuration, documentation and control procedures.
- Visiting work sites before the design begins, during the design and construction phases, and during the testing and commissioning phases.
- Independently accessing all TTC properties, construction sites, and track level on a 24hr basis, 7 days a week.
- Collecting data, performing asset/equipment inventory audits and asset identification/labelling.
- Administering the construction, inspection and commissioning of various electrical Capital State of Good Repair replacement and Operating maintenance repair projects.
- Providing engineering guidance to staff and field personnel, troubleshooting operational problems and providing engineering solutions for existing and new electrical systems.

- Your educational background will consist of the completion of a post-secondary college diploma or university degree in a related discipline (i.e., Electrical Engineering) or a combination of education, training and experience deemed to be equivalent.
- Registration with or working towards PEO status with the Professional Engineers of Ontario is an asset.
- Your application will demonstrate related work experience.
- You will have technical knowledge with Industrial and Commercial Power Systems including switchgear, transformers, lighting, power system distribution, electrical grounding, protection and metering as well as power systems electrical test equipment.
- You will also have knowledge of AC and DC power systems design principles and electrical engineering principles, methods and practices.
- Your proficiency with MicroStation/AutoCAD and other computer applications applicable to the work (i.e., MS Word, Excel, Outlook etc.) will be beneficial in this role.
- You will have sound judgement and well developed technical, analytical, problem solving, interpersonal, verbal communication and engineering report writing skills.
- You will also have knowledge of applicable electrical, safety codes/practices/standards.
- As a successful candidate you will acquire Subway Rulebook Certification.
